 Strong 6.1 Magnitude Earthquake Hits Indonesia's Sulawesi Island

A powerful earthquake measuring 6.1 on the Richter scale hit Indonesia's Sulawesi Island, causing shockwaves across the region. The earthquake, which happened at a relatively shallow depth, caused widespread panic among the residents, who rushed to find safety.

The epicenter of the earthquake, according to news reports, was in the region of Sulawesi, known for its volcanic history. The effects of the quake were reported across the island, with its residents experiencing shaking and tremors that lasted up to several seconds.

Indonesian officials swiftly moved into action, sending emergency workers and rescue teams to the affected regions. Though preliminary reports indicate little damage from the earthquake, officials are carrying out extensive surveys to assess the extent of the damage.

The earthquake is a grim reminder of Indonesia's position on the Pacific Ring of Fire, which is seismically and volcanically active. Indonesia has suffered many destructive earthquakes in recent times, causing widespread loss of life and property.
